This resource has 8 sets of multiplication quizzes, one set per week. Each set is labeled with A, B, C.  The half page quiz can be given to your 5th grade students with a 5 minute time limit. Set A is for students at grade level, Set B is for students below grade level, and Set C is for students who want a challenge.  This is a great way to have your students practicing the standard algorithm for multiplication. Teaching style

As an educator, my goal is to create culturally relevant learning experiences that inspire students to become lifelong learners. I use project-based learning to foster an interactive environment where risk-taking is encouraged as part of the learning process. In my classroom, curiosity is not only valued but also nurtured through hands-on experimentation and discovery. I believe that strong learning experiences come from having a well-organized space and routines that support the needs of diverse learners. I’m also passionate about helping students grow by building a strong classroom community and encouraging continuous reflection and goal setting.
